Do you need a license to buy an automobile?
Based on the laws in your state, you might be able to purchase an automobile without a license. You may run into issues when you try to enroll or insure your car. Some insurers, like will require that the registered owner be the principal insured driver. This means that if you don't have a license, you'll need to add someone else to the insurance policy to be able to get it in place.
You may require a special license to drive certain types of cars, such as trucks or motorcycles. These licenses have different weight restrictions and curfews in comparison to standard drivers' licenses. It is best to check with your local DMV to learn more about the different classes of licenses.
If you frequent Canada or Mexico, an enhanced license may be required. These types of licenses combine the functions of the regular driver's license as well as an ID card, and are generally more convenient for travelers.
While you can purchase the vehicle without a driver's license in certain cases, it's not always possible to do so. Many dealerships won't let you test drive a vehicle unless you possess a valid license. In addition, lenders may typically require a copy of your driver's license when you apply for an auto loan. However, some banks will accept loans for those who don't have a driver's licence, as long as they have a valid government issued photo ID. This is true, especially if you are buying the car with cash. If you intend to finance your purchase with an installment loan from a bank, it may be more difficult. This is because a lender will usually want to ensure that the person who will be accountable for the repayment of the loan has a good credit history and a stable income.
